Mississippi State Penitentiary (MSP), also known as Parchman Farm, is a maximum-security prison farm located in unincorporated Sunflower County, Mississippi, in the Mississippi Delta region. At the end of 2019, the number of correctional officers, 732, was fewer than half the number of guards five years earlier, according to the Mississippi State Personnel Board.
